Eagles Defeat Lions 44-6 in District Opener

The Fairfield Eagles traveled to Teague on Friday night, Oct. 11, and defeated the Lions 44-6 in their district opener. Fairfield moves to 6-0 overall and Tegaue goes to 3-3.

“It is a big deal to win the first district game,” Fairfield Head Coach John Bachtel said. “The goal every year is to win the first regular season game because that starts the season off on a great note, to win the first district game because that starts district off on a great note, and to win the playoff game. We break the year up into three short seasons. So, it was a big win. And it is always a big win when you beat your cross town rival.”

Fairfield had 226 rushing yards. Jason Brackens had 63 yards, Khamrion Ingram and Kohl Collins 57 yards each, and Kyden Rodriguez 49 yards.
